Elevate your space—or gift something truly memorable—with the Petite Pink Anthurium Kokedama, a refined expression of tropical beauty in living form. Known for its glossy, heart-shaped leaves and long-lasting blooms, the anthurium—often called the flaming flower—symbolizes hospitality, warmth, and abundance.

This petite variety features smaller, more delicate blooms than a traditional anthurium, offering a softer, more intricate expression of color while maintaining its signature vibrancy. Handcrafted in the Japanese art of kokedama, the plant’s roots are wrapped in a sculpted moss ball, allowing it to exist as both plant and sculpture—bringing a sense of quiet intention to any space.

With bright, indirect light and higher humidity, this anthurium can bloom throughout the year—offering long-lasting color that evolves beautifully over time.

🌿 About the Plant

  • Latin Name: Anthurium andraeanum
  • Common Names: Flaming Flower, Laceleaf
  • Origin: Native to the tropical rainforests of Central and South America

What It’s Known For:

  • Long-lasting, waxy blooms that can last for weeks to months
  • Glossy, heart-shaped foliage
  • Symbolism of love, hospitality, and warmth

🌱 Care Instructions

Light:
Place in bright, indirect light. Avoid direct sun, which can scorch the leaves and blooms.

Watering:
Water when the moss ball feels light. Soak the moss ball in water for 10–15 minutes until fully saturated, then allow it to drain completely.

Humidity:
Thrives in moderate to high humidity. Ideal for kitchens, bathrooms, or near a humidifier.

Temperature:
Prefers warm environments between 65–80°F. Avoid cold drafts and temperatures below 55°F.

Blooming:
With bright, indirect light and higher humidity, anthuriums can bloom throughout the year. Each bloom is long-lasting, often holding its color and form for several months.
